Stackoverflow-Clone-Frontend 项目教程

Stackoverflow-Clone-Frontend 项目教程

Stackoverflow-Clone-FrontendClone project of a famous Q/A website for developers built using MySQL, Express, React, Node, Sequelize :globe_with_meridians:项目地址:https://gitcode.com/gh_mirrors/st/Stackoverflow-Clone-Frontend

项目介绍

Stackoverflow-Clone-Frontend 是一个模仿著名开发者问答网站 Stack Overflow 的前端项目。该项目由 Mayank0255 开发,使用了 MERN 技术栈(MySQL, Express, React, Node.js)。前端框架采用 React.js(结合 Redux),样式使用 SASS 和 BOOTSTRAP。后端处理请求使用 Node.js 和 Express.js 框架,数据库则采用 MySQL 配合 Sequelize。

项目快速启动

环境准备

确保你已经安装了 Node.js 和 MySQL。

克隆项目

git clone https://github.com/Mayank0255/Stackoverflow-Clone-Frontend.git
cd Stackoverflow-Clone-Frontend

安装依赖

npm install

配置环境变量

创建一个 .env 文件,格式可以参考 .env.example

启动项目

npm start

应用案例和最佳实践

应用案例

Stackoverflow-Clone-Frontend 可以作为一个基础模板,用于开发类似 Stack Overflow 的问答社区网站。它展示了如何使用 React 和 Redux 管理复杂的状态,以及如何与后端 API 进行交互。

最佳实践

  1. 状态管理:使用 Redux 来管理应用的状态,确保状态的一致性和可预测性。
  2. 组件化:将 UI 分解为独立的、可重用的组件,提高代码的可维护性和复用性。
  3. API 交互:使用 Axios 或其他 HTTP 客户端与后端 API 进行交互,确保数据的有效性和安全性。

典型生态项目

Stackoverflow-Clone-Backend

这是 Stackoverflow-Clone-Frontend 的后端项目,同样由 Mayank0255 开发。它提供了必要的 API 接口,用于处理前端的请求和数据存储。

其他相关项目

  • React-Redux 官方文档:提供了关于如何使用 React 和 Redux 的详细指南。
  • Node.js 和 Express.js 官方文档:提供了关于如何使用 Node.js 和 Express.js 构建后端服务的详细指南。
  • MySQL 和 Sequelize 官方文档:提供了关于如何使用 MySQL 和 Sequelize 进行数据库操作的详细指南。

通过结合这些生态项目和官方文档,可以更深入地理解和应用 Stackoverflow-Clone-Frontend 项目。

Stackoverflow-Clone-FrontendClone project of a famous Q/A website for developers built using MySQL, Express, React, Node, Sequelize :globe_with_meridians:项目地址:https://gitcode.com/gh_mirrors/st/Stackoverflow-Clone-Frontend

  • 15
    点赞
  • 13
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

林浪其Geneva

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值